diff --git a/.config/Code/User/settings.json b/.config/Code/User/settings.json index 18b8598..acb9edd 100644 --- a/.config/Code/User/settings.json +++ b/.config/Code/User/settings.json @@ -2,37 +2,59 @@ "window.autoDetectColorScheme": true, "workbench.preferredDarkColorTheme": "Solarized Dark", "workbench.preferredLightColorTheme": "Solarized Light", + "workbench.colorTheme": "Solarized Dark", "workbench.startupEditor": "none", + "editor.minimap.showSlider": "always", + "editor.minimap.enabled": false, + "editor.rulers": [ + 80, + ], "files.autoSave": "afterDelay", - "gitlens.statusBar.enabled": false, "vim.normalModeKeyBindings": [ { "before": [ - "K" + "K", ], "commands": [ - "editor.action.showHover" + "editor.action.showHover", ], }, { "before": [ "", "r", - "f" + "f", ], "commands": [ - "fileutils.renameFile" + "fileutils.renameFile", ], }, { "before": [ "", - "f" + "f", ], "commands": [ - "editor.action.formatDocument" + "editor.action.formatDocument", + ], + }, + { + "before": [ + "", + "b", + ], + "commands": [ + "workbench.action.maximizeEditor", ], }, ], - "workbench.colorTheme": "Solarized Dark", -} + "redhat.telemetry.enabled": false, + "git.autofetch": true, + "gitlens.statusBar.enabled": false, + "gitlab.aiAssistedCodeSuggestions.enabled": true, + "docker.containers.label": "ContainerName", + "docker.containers.description": [ + "Image", + "Status", + ], +} \ No newline at end of file diff --git a/.zshrc b/.zshrc index 70a49aa..41c8523 100644 --- a/.zshrc +++ b/.zshrc @@ -540,6 +540,7 @@ function theme { export LIGHT=true echo "export LIGHT=true" > ~/.zshrc-theme gnome_theme=Adwaita + gnome_color_scheme=prefer-light macos_theme=false ;; dark) @@ -548,6 +549,7 @@ function theme { export LIGHT=false echo "export LIGHT=false" > ~/.zshrc-theme gnome_theme=Adwaita-dark + gnome_color_scheme=prefer-dark macos_theme=true ;; esac @@ -565,6 +567,7 @@ function theme { if [[ -z "$SSH_CLIENT" ]]; then if [[ $PLATFORM == linux ]] && which gsettings 2>&1 >/dev/null; then gsettings set org.gnome.desktop.interface gtk-theme $gnome_theme + gsettings set org.gnome.desktop.interface color-scheme $gnome_color_scheme fi if [[ $PLATFORM == macos ]]; then osascript -e "tell app \"System Events\" to tell appearance preferences to set dark mode to $macos_theme"